Piers Morgan tells Debbie Bright to ‘follow a Love Islander’

Piers Morgan has entered into a war of words with Lydia Bright’s mum after she accused him of being a negative influence.
The 55-year-old broadcaster hit back at Debbie Bright after she blasted him on Twitter for being constantly negative during the coronavirus pandemic.
Debbie, 56, wrote on the micro-blogging platform: "Can’t deal with Piers Morgan anymore.
"Started well asking some important questions now all he wanna do is bring people in, interrupt them and try to embarrass them and be negative.
"He’s lost the plot. Someone from his household give him a big cuddle and tell him to relax. (sic)"
Debbie accused Piers of lowering the mood of the nation by airing his personal views of the pandemic on ‘Good Morning Britain’.
She tweeted: "I said the same yesterday… I truly cannot deal with his negativity every day.
"Life is difficult enough we all need to be uplifted not constantly put into low moods. (sic)"
But Piers – who has been outspoken amid the pandemic – hit back at Debbie, telling her to follow a ‘Love Island’ star instead.
He wrote: "Why do you follow me then? If you want constant uplifting positivity as 60,000 have died from Govt negligence, go follow a Love Islander or something. (sic)"
The TV star – who presents ‘Good Morning Britain’ alongside Susanna Reid – subsequently revealed he’s blocked Debbie on Twitter.
He wrote: "I’ve had to block her now, she was being too negative about me… (sic)"
